Log Siding Replacement in Boston, MA
Log siding replacement services involve removing damaged or aging log siding and installing new, durable materials to restore the appearance and integrity of a property's exterior. This project typically covers homes with log or wood siding, including cabins, cottages, and rustic-style residences. Property owners often seek this service when their existing siding shows signs of rot, warping, cracking, or insect damage, or when they want to upgrade to a more weather-resistant or low-maintenance option. Log Siding Replacement Questions
What are log siding replacement services? They involve removing damaged or old log siding and installing new logs to restore the exterior appearance and protection of a property.
When is log siding replacement necessary? Replacement is needed when logs are severely rotted, cracked, or compromised by pests, affecting the structure's integrity.
What types of log siding can be installed? Various options include traditional wood logs, engineered logs, and maintenance-free composites, depending on the property's needs.
What should property owners consider before replacing log siding? It's important to assess the condition of existing logs, choose suitable materials, and plan for proper installation to ensure durability.
